Transaction 35affbd099d950ae00ca93ef100341b11d4d407916005f0fa2fdd31bb694d9b9
1 Input
1 Output
-
35affbd099d950ae00ca93ef100341b11d4d407916005f0fa2fdd31bb694d9b9:0
- value
- 625125
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d1fe93906289559d4014f5525bc53ff056e77fe OP_EQUAL
- address
- 3ABQzbouCegrxvL8hAonh97sezv8LY1kNY